Monsoon-Induced Trade Routes in Ancient Southeast Asia

Monsoon-induced trade routes in ancient Southeast Asia were primarily shaped by seasonal wind patterns, enabling predictable maritime navigation. These routes aligned with the monsoon cycles, facilitating efficient movement of ships during favorable seasons.

Sea traders utilized the timing of monsoon winds to plan their voyages, often sailing with the wind’s assistance. The southwest monsoon supported voyages from the Indian Ocean towards Southeast Asia, while the northeast monsoon enabled return journeys.

Key trade corridors emerged along the coastlines and across the maritime poles, connecting regions such as present-day India, Sri Lanka, the Malay Peninsula, and the Indonesian archipelago. These routes fostered regional integration and economic exchange.

Monsoon Winds and the Rise of Maritime Empires in Southeast Asia

Monsoon winds significantly contributed to the emergence and expansion of maritime empires in Southeast Asia. These predictable seasonal wind patterns allowed early civilizations to undertake long-distance voyages reliably and efficiently. The monsoon system facilitated trade and political dominance by shaping maritime routes favored during specific seasons.

Controlling key monsoon-driven trade routes enabled empires like Srivijaya and Majapahit to grow wealthy and powerful. Their strategic geographic position alongside wind-dependent navigation allowed them to dominate regional commerce and influence neighboring territories.
